Group 1: Corporate Earnings - JPMorgan Chase & Co. exceeded analyst expectations for the fourth quarter, resulting in a 1% increase in premarket trading shares, with stronger-than-forecasted trading revenue [2][3] - Delta Air Lines shares fell 5% after reporting slightly lower revenue than anticipated for the fourth quarter, but it beat earnings per share expectations and projected a 20% profit increase in 2026, citing strong travel demand [5][6] Group 2: Market Reactions - Bank stocks, including JPMorgan, faced a challenging session following President Trump's proposal for a 10% cap on credit card interest rates, which industry executives view as potentially harmful to their business models [4] - Shares of Alphabet rose after the announcement of an AI-powered upgrade for Siri, helping the company reach a $4 trillion market cap [10][11] Group 3: Economic Policies - President Trump announced a 25% tariff on any country doing business with Iran, aimed at economically isolating the country, following threats of military action over the killing of anti-government protesters [8][9]
